I have not made chicken soup for a while now, but while shopping yesterday I bought 3 pk fresh chickens and I thought of making a delicious chicken soup, so here I am.
First I cut the chicken into parts and cooked it on low heat for 4 hours in a large pot of water with some garlic, onion, bay leafs, maggi leafs, salt, soya soup seasoning, chicken spice ( cubitos), celery and fresh chopped parsley.
As for veggies, I added some carrots, potatoes, chayote squash, bok choy and celery.
The first veggies I put in soup was carrots and about 10 min. after I put the chayote squash and 10 min after I added potatoes and last I would add bok choy.
I also made some fresh tortillas while the soup was cooking.
The soup was delicious.
